World of Warcraft Emotes

Everyone loves emotes! Emotes are pre-generated macro sayings and actions that just require the proper code (text/name) to activate. To perform an emote type "/emotename". You can create your own emotes by typing "/em text".

The text is changed based on who you have selected as a target. To remove a target, press the ESC key. If you do not have a target, most emotes will give special, sometimes especially funny text. If you select a specific person, such as yourself or another player, the text generated will often work that player's name into the text. Make sure you select the right person before doing the emote and give it a try: Type: "/thank". -> "You thank everyone around you."
Type: "/thank" (while selecting someone). -> "You thank Furen Longbeard." Some emotes have animations, some do not. Emotes with a x in the A column are animated.
Some emotes have voices, some do not. Emotes with a x in the V column are voiced by your character.
